What is the value of h in the figure below? In this diagram BAD~CBD
liberstina [14]

Answer:

The correct option is E. 8

The value of h is 8 unit.

Step-by-step explanation:

Given:

Δ BAD ~ Δ CBD

AC = 20

DC = 4

∴ AD = AC - DC=20-4=16

To Find:

h = ?

Solution:

Δ BAD ~ Δ CBD      ................Given

If two triangles are similar then their sides are in proportion.

\frac{BD}{CD} =\frac{AD}{BD} =\frac{BA}{CB}\ \textrm{corresponding sides of similar triangles are in proportion}\\  

On substituting the given values we get

\dfrac{BD}{CD} =\dfrac{AD}{BD}

\dfrac{h}{4} =\dfrac{16}{h}\\\therefore h^{2}=64\\\therefore h=8\ unit

The value of h is 8 unit.

Seams Personal advertises on its website that 95% of customer orders are received within four working days. They performed an au
Bezzdna [24]

Answer:

a. Yes(n=500>=5, n(1-p)=25>=5)

b. 0.15241

Step-by-step explanation:

a. A normal approximation to the binomial can be used  n\geq5 and n(1-p)>=5:

#We calculate our p as follows:

\hat p=x/n=470/500=0.94

n=500

n(1-p)=500(1-0.95)=25

Hence, we can use the normal approximation.

b. This is a normal approximation.

-Given that p=0.95(95%)

-We verify if our distribution can be approximated to a normal:

np=0.95\times 500=475\\n(1-p)=500(1-0.95)=25\\\\np\geq 5,\ n(1-p)\geq 5

Hence, we can use the normal approximation of the form:

P_{bin}(k,n,p)->N(\mu,\sigma^2)\left \{ {{\mu=np=475} \atop {\sigma=\sqrt{np(1-p)}=4.8734}} \right. \\\\\\P_{bin}(k\leq 470)\approx P_{norm}(x\leq 470.5)=P_{norm}(z\leq \frac{470-475}{4.8734})\\\\P_{norm}(z\leq -1.0260)=0.15241

Hence, the probability of the sample proportion  is the same as the proportion of the sample found is 0.15241
